21,917 Steps to Miles, By Height
The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 21,917 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.
| Height | Distance |
|---|---|
| Short (~5'2") | 8.88 mi |
| Average (~5'7") | 9.59 mi |
| Tall (~6'2") | 10.60 mi |

Where 21,917 Steps Ranks
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 21,917 steps falls.
| Activity Level | Daily Steps |
|---|---|
| Sedentary | Under 5,000 |
| Low Active | 5,000–7,499 |
| Somewhat Active | 7,500–9,999 |
| Active | 10,000–12,499 |
| Highly Active | 12,500+ |

Northern elephant seals migrate up to 12,000 to 21,000 miles a year at sea, the longest migration of any mammal. Set against that, even a full marathon's 26.2 miles barely registers.
Charles Darwin walked a fixed loop near his home every day, he called it his "Sandwalk" and used it to think through his ideas, including parts of what became On the Origin of Species.
